Look at the drawing given in the figure which has been drawn with ink of uniform line-thickness. The mass of ink used to draw each of the two inner circles, and each of the two line segments is `m`. The mass of the ink used to draw the outer circle is `6m`.
The coordinates of the centres of the different parts are: outer circle `(0, 0)`, left inner circle `(-a, a)`, right inner circle `(a, a)`, vertical line `(0, 0)` and horizontal line `(0, -a)`. The `y`-coordinate of the centre of mass of the ink in this drawing is

A

`a//10`

B

`a//8`

C

`a//12`

D

`a//3`

Text Solution

Verified by Experts

The correct Answer is:
A

`Y_(CM)=(m_(1)y_(1)+m_(2)y_(2)+m_(3)y_(3)+m_(4)y_(4)+m_(5)y_(5))/(m_(1)+m_(2)+m_(3)+m_(4)+m_(5))`
= `(6mxx0+mxxa+ma+mxx0+mxx-a)/(10m)=(a)/(10)`
